Leave the infirmary and head to the bridge. If you like, you can also talk at Rinoa if you head to the infirmary. (Here we go again - all these FF7 trigger memories.)
Head to the Training Center and go to the left branch, there’s a MagazineWeapons Monthly issue: Disc 2; for Squall; found at Garden Training Center after Garden Battle; can be bought at Esthar Book Store; unlocks Twin Lance, Rising Sun, Bismarck, Crescent Wish. magazine laying on the ground there.
If you haven’t already, this is your last real chance to take on the Balamb Garden Card Club (hopefully you haven’t spread Random and you’ve been winning lots of great cards throughout the first two discs).
Head up to the bridge and talk to Nida to go to Edea’s house. Exit the Garden and approach on foot. If you walk along the shoreline due west of the house and keep pressing X, you should eventually find a Holy draw point. When you get to Edea’s house, the first screen up has an old issue of Magazine SeriesMagazine series that unlocks Laguna stories on the Garden computer., and the next screen to the left has a Curaga draw point. Cid will appear from the right, and talking with him will allow you to go on to the next screen. As soon as you do, you’re able to play cards against Edea and win the Edea Card from her.
When you’re ready to advance the story, talk to Edea a few times. You’ll learn all sorts of things. If you seem lost at Edea’s house, just try to leave and everything should work itself out.

You probably think you should be searching for a ship right now, but hold that thought for a moment. What you should actually do is check that Squall has junctioned his SystemGuardian Forces are FF8's summons and the source of most junction, command, support, refine, and stat-growth abilities. and at least one other character has too; make sure you remember which character it is. If Squall and this character already know Flare or Meteor, consider transferring their magic to someone else, as you’ll be able to draw these from an enemy soon. Obviously be sure you’ve freed up the requisite magic space on these characters as well. When you’re ready, go talk to Rinoa in the infirmary and the scene will switch to Laguna.

Remember I said to check Squall and another character’s junction earlier? Here’s why. Now we see Laguna’s acting career. Watch the scene play out. I’m not sure if this is the Marx Brothers or the Three Stooges. Soon you’ll enter a battle with a dragon. If you get knocked down and select “I’m done for…” the game will actually end, which feels like punishing the player for suspecting an anachronism. Just tell the game you want another try. The best way I’ve found to get through this is to never defend and just use triangle as fast as possible to keep attacking, thereby preventing him from attacking. When you knock down the dragon, Laguna will call for Kiros.

When you talk to Edea you will get a piece of paper that allows you to board the white ship. You can spend a lot of time trying to find this ship, so try this instead:
- Take the Garden to Edea’s house.
- Head north until you see some forest.
- Go forward and float above the island in front of you.
- That orange thing that just showed up north and slightly east is the ship.
